RPE Scale (No Measure)
We want the programmed RPE to be based off of our first few sets. Naturally as we get later into the sets what once felt like a 5/10 RPE will begin to get more difficult, but should remain doable and safe for all sets.
**RPE = Rate of Perceived Exertion**
RPE 10 = 0 reps left (max effort)
RPE 9.5 = Maybe 1 rep left
RPE 9 = 1 rep left
RPE 8.5 = 1-2 reps left
RPE 8 = 2 reps left
RPE 7 = 3 reps left
RPE 6.5 = 4 reps left
RPE 6 = 6+ reps left
RPE 5.5 = 8+ reps left
RPE 5 = 10+ reps left

Double Dumbbell Seal Row
Weighted Strict Pull Up
Set up the bench so it’s high enough off the ground that your arms can fully extend below it while lying flat.
Lie face-down on the bench with a dumbbell in each hand.
Let your arms hang straight down toward the floor — this is your starting position.
Row the dumbbells up by squeezing your shoulder blades together, keeping your elbows tight to your body or flaring slightly (depending on what you’re targeting).
Pause at the top and squeeze your upper back.

Dumbbell Chainsaw Row
Setup:
Place your left hand and left knee on a bench for support, if needed.
Your right foot should be firmly planted on the floor.
Hold a dumbbell in your right hand, letting it hang straight down below your shoulder.
Positioning:
Keep your back flat, chest up, and core engaged.
Your torso should be roughly parallel to the floor.
Execution:
Pull the dumbbell up in a controlled arc, driving your elbow toward your ribcage or slightly past it.
Squeeze your back muscles (especially the lats and rhomboids) at the top of the movement.
Keep your elbow close to your body (don’t flare it out).

Dumbbell Reverse Curls
Stand tall with a dumbbell in each hand. Hold them with a pronated grip (palms facing your thighs). Arms fully extended, elbows close to your sides. Keeping your palms facing down, alternately curl the dumbbells up toward your shoulders. Only move at the elbows — avoid swinging or using momentum. Curl until your forearms are nearly horizontal or dumbbells reach chest level. Squeeze your forearms and biceps briefly. Slowly lower the dumbbells back to the starting position.
